Is White County, GA Safe from Robbery?

The B grade means the rate of robbery is slightly lower than the average US county. White County is in the 69th percentile for safety, meaning 31% of counties are safer and 69% of counties are more dangerous. This analysis applies to White County's proper boundaries only. See the table on nearby places below for nearby counties.

The rate of robbery in White County is 0.3498 per 1,000 residents during a standard year. People who live in White County generally consider the south part of the county to be the safest.

Your chance of being a victim of robbery in White County may be as high as 1 in 1,615 in the northwest neighborhoods, or as low as 1 in 3,585 in the south part of the county.

By a simple count ignoring population, more robbery occurs in the west parts of White County, GA: about 2 per year. The north part of White County has fewer cases of robbery with only 0 in a typical year.

How White County's Robbery Rate Compares

The chart below compares the robbery rate in White County to the Georgia state average and the national average. All rates are the number of crimes per 1,000 residents in a standard year.

White County, GA: 0.3498
Georgia: 0.3983
USA: 0.6421

Considering only the robbery rate, White County is safer than the Georgia state average and safer than the national average.

The Cost of Robbery in White County, GA

Robbery is projected to cost the residents of White County about $298,116 in 2025, or roughly $11 per resident. This is part of White County's overall Cost of Crime™. See the full cost-of-crime breakdown for White County, including every crime type and how White County compares to other counties.

Interpreting the Robbery Map

Remember that robbery rates are measured per resident. Places with heavy daytime traffic, like shopping districts, airports, and parks, can look more dangerous than they are for the people who live there. See a full guide to reading White County's crime maps on the White County overall crime page.
